Glam Rock band Rama Amoeba will perform in Europe for the first time in November.
Rama Amoeba is an old school quartet, formed last autumn by leader Tsuneo Akima, an emblem of Japanese glam, thanks to his band Marchosias Vamps which was active between 1985 and 1996. Last July, Rama Amoeba releasedthe album Hello! End Of The World, which covered some of Marchosias Vamps' old songs. At the same time, the compilation Golden Age Of Glam Rock was released, where the band covered hit songs from David Bowie, New York Doll, T-Rex, Slade and more.
The band will accompany TOKYO DECADANCE for some of this tour, which will begin on November 10th in France. The band will also take part in the first international glam festival, Glamarama 2009, which will be held in Paris on November 11th with various glam and rock'n'roll bands from Sweden and Germany. The tour currently only has three official dates, though there are two more which are still to be confirmed.
